SUMMARY
Completes all work assigned by the supervisor, manager or shop foreman. Functions as a skilled-level technician who is able to perform diagnoses and repairs in all areas, on numerous makes and models, in addition to being specialized in particular areas of repair.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ES/REQUIRMENTS include the following. Other duties may be assigned.
- Works alongside an assigned technician to learn to perform quality vehicle service maintenance and repairs.
- Assists assigned technician as needed.
- Delivers customer cars to service stalls as requested by technicians.
- Picks up parts from the parts department as directed by technicians.
- Performs safety inspections, oil changes, lubrication work, basic maintenance, and minor repairs as directed.
- Replenishes supplies as requested by technicians or service manager.
- Reports machinery defects or malfunctions to supervisor.
- Attends training classes and departmental meetings.
- Operates all tools and equipment in a safe manner.
- Provide coverage for other positions in the Service Express as needed (backfill for lunches, illness, vacation, etc).
- Perform other tasks as directed by Manager.
- Inspects vehicles for noticeable defects, such as dents, scratches, torn upholstery, and poor mechanical operation.
- Uses proper eye, hand, and body protection when using products that require protection.
- Maintains shop in clean and presentable condition at all times.
- Parks cars as directed by Service Manager.
- Operates all tools and equipment in a safe manner.
- Reports any safety issues immediately to management.
- Cooperates and assists other personnel in the repair and prepping of vehicles.
